“I just saw this film in LA at Outfest and I loved it. This film is well directed, acted, and shot. The subject matter may be challenging for some but the relationships were very real and contemporary. Young people are more open-minded about sexual identity and its many challenges and the director presents the issue of homosexuality in a way that makes it seem so natural to the situation. Mr. Castle elicits some strong performances from his neophyte cast which reminded me of Coppolau0026#39;s work with his young actors in The Outsiders. I also thought the adults were integrated into the story in a very real way–these arenu0026#39;t absent parents but people in their kidsu0026#39; lives. The surfing camera work is stupendous. Donu0026#39;t miss!”
